clang-format-find
helps you find the clang-format style that best fits your
current code style, to help you more consistently apply your chosen style.
It does this by starting from the LLVM style included with clang-format
,
iterating over a number of values for each option (including undefined),
then comparing the result by counting the size of a unified diff of the
original file contents to the formatted file results.
This is a fork of the original by Dirkjan Ochtman, adding Python 3 support and some other fixes.
